Clad in mail, never clinking.
Dies on dry land.
Thinks a fountain is a puff of air.
Never thirsty, ever drinking.
What am I?

a fish
from the hobbit
told by smegol
mail=scales
dies on dry land becuase needs oxygen in water
lives in water so likes water like a puff of air
drinks water thought gills
